Главная
О родном
ФОТО
Услуги
Статьи
Игры
Гостевая
Контакты

Arsenyev.net

Ars-tgue.info

Крутой сайт

DJMORS

PiddleSoft.Narod.RU

Переменные – это…

Если у вас уже есть опыт в программировании, то все же рекомендую прочитать эту статью, потому что в php есть много отличий. Я понимаю что в статье все слишком разжевано.
Переменная - это средство языка для хранения данных, т.е «что-то» должно хранить определенные значения это «что-то» есть переменная. У любой переменной есть имя (идентификатор) и значение, которое мы и храним. Смотри пример 1.


Пример 1:
<?php

$peremen = 5     // Задаем (=) переменной ($peremen) значение (5)

echo $peremen     // вывод (echo) значение переменной ($peremen)

?>


Переменная имеет имя $peremen, а с помощью знака (=) ее значение становиться 5. Теперь вместо этого значения (5) мы можем использовать переменную ($peremen), как это и делается во второй строчке. В результате наших стараний в окно браузера выведется число 5. Но переменные можно и изменять, т.е изменять их значение на то и они и переменные.Смотри пример 2.


Пример 2:
<?php

$peremen = 17;     //Присваиваем (=) переменной ($peremen) значение 17

$peremen = $peremen + 3     // Увеличиваем значение (17) переменной ($peremen) на 3

echo $peremen;     // Выводит 20

?>


Значение переменной $peremen изменилось с 17 на 20 посредством прибавления 3. Переменную можно назвать как душе угодно $mama, $papa, $peta., но имя переменной должно начинаться со знака доллара ($) и после него может идти либо буква, либо знак подчеркивания (_), но не цифра, далее могут следовать буквы, цифры символы подчеркивания в любой последовательности (знак пробела недопустим). Имена переменных чувствительны к регистру $peremen и $Peremen не эквивалентны. Если вы не будите придерживаться этого свода правил, то программа вызовет ошибку и просто не будет работать.


P.S Старайтесь выбирать имя переменной так, чтобы можно было понять смысл хранимой информации. Это поможет при работе с большими программами где может быть сотни, и даже тысячи переменных.

Радченко Максим.
radchenko-max@rambler.ru

Hosted by uCoz